Last Friday, I inadvertently found myself in the midst of the opening salvo of a battle to turn the Twin Cities upside down next year.
I was driving home at rush hour from downtown Minneapolis, when several hundred bicyclists blocked the street leading to Interstate 394.
My fellow motorists and I sat obligingly for several minutes, missing green light after green light. Finally, folks began angrily honking their horns. If two police cars hadn't moved the riders along, people might have leaped from their cars to take on the bicyclists themselves.
Later, the protest ride turned ugly. Two officers tried to arrest several riders who covered their faces with hoods while blocking motorists. They resisted, and about 30 protesters surrounded the officers, chanting "Let them go! Let them go!"
Forty-eight law enforcement personnel from six agencies responded to a police call for help, and chemical spray was used to control the crowd. Nineteen demonstrators were arrested.
Get ready, Minnesotans. The protest was "a kick-off" for a "weekend of organizing against the Republican National Convention" to be held here in September 2008, according to the RNC Welcoming Committee, a local anarchist group.
Across the country, similar groups have announced their intention to cause havoc in our cities next year.
Annette Meeks has seen these tactics before. In 2004, she was a delegate to the GOP convention in New York City.
Meeks, my former colleague at Center of the American Experiment, said that many of the protesters in New York differed markedly from their predecessors.
"It used to be peaceful ex-hippies with placards -- they're almost quaint by today's standards," she said. "In New York we saw a professional class of protesters, with an angry, violent mob mentality.
